This is the role

  • Maintain the site Health & Safety system and ensure compliance with Romanian law and Rockwool Group standards.
  • Lead risk assessments (JHA/TRA) and implement required control measures.
  • Prepare and update annual prevention & protection and training plans, PPE policy and related records.
  • Develop and maintain emergency response and evacuation plans.
  • Manage incident investigations, accident records and reporting; coordinate communications with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Produce safe‑work instructions, deliver machine‑safety training and issue work permits/visitor safety briefings.
  • Organise mandatory safety training (fire protection, first aid, forklift/crane/excavator, hazardous substances, etc.).
  • Arrange periodic medical checks and keep training and medical records up to date.
  • Procure, inspect and manage safety equipment and PPE stock.
  • Coordinate workplace safety testing (electrical, microclimate, noise) and run evacuation drills.
  • Convene the Health & Safety Committee, prepare minutes and track action plans.
  • Support internal/external audits and prepare statutory and Group H&S reports.
  • Provide regular H&S information to managers and support continuous improvement initiatives.


Requirements:

  • University degree in Engineering (Chemical / Mechanical / Mining). Additional studies specifically in occupational health & safety are an advantage.
  • Computer skills (SAP is an advantage).
  • Solid knowledge of Romanian occupational health & safety legislation.
  • Certification as an occupational health & safety specialist from an 80‑ or 120‑hour accredited course.
  • Postgraduate course in risk assessment of at least 180 hours.
  • Technical Fire Safety (PSI) training and certification is an advantage.
  • Internal or external auditor certification for OHSAS 18001 (recent ISO 9001, ISO 14001 experience is an advantage).
  • Fluent Romanian and English (written and spoken).
